Why do I feel bad after eating fried food?

Your gallbladder is an organ that sits in the upper right side of your abdomen. It helps your body digest fats. Gallstones and other gallbladder diseases can affect your ability to digest fats. As a result, you’ll feel sick to your stomach, especially after you eat a rich, fatty meal.

What happens when we eat lot of fried food?

Eating Fried Foods May Increase Your Risk of Disease. Several studies in adults have found an association between eating fried foods and the risk of chronic disease. Generally speaking, eating more fried foods is associated with a greater risk of developing type 2 diabetes, heart disease and obesity ( 12 ).

How do I stop feeling sick after greasy food?

Try these tips to avoid feeling sick after you eat:

  1. Suck on ice cubes or crushed ice.
  2. Avoid greasy, fried, or spicy foods.
  3. Eat mainly bland foods, such as crackers or toast.
  4. Eat smaller meals more frequently, instead of three large meals.
  5. Relax and sit still after you eat to give your food time to digest.

Why do I feel good after eating?

Our brains reward us for it, by releasing pleasure chemicals — in the same way as drugs and alcohol, experts say. Scientists studying that good feeling after eating call it ingestion analgesia, literally pain relief from eating.

Why do I feel sick an hour after eating?

When appearing shortly after a meal, nausea or vomiting may be caused by food poisoning, gastritis (inflammation of the stomach lining), an ulcer, or bulimia. Nausea or vomiting one to eight hours after a meal may also indicate food poisoning.

Can greasy food upset your stomach?

Greasy meals delay stomach emptying and may cause bloating, nausea, and stomach pain. In people with certain digestive conditions, these foods may worsen symptoms like cramping and diarrhea.

How bad is fried chicken for you?

One or more serving of fried chicken a day was linked to a 13% higher risk of death from any cause. A regular serving of fried chicken or fish is associated with a higher risk of death from any cause except cancer, according to a new study done in postmenopausal women in the United States.
